Social Media is a Marketing Must

\"Website

With eCommerce sales reaching an all-time high in 2012, companies are trying everything possible to sustain their success and drive more consumers to their websites. Enhanced website design from a professional website development company, search engine optimization (SEO), and dynamic content are all ways to accomplish this. In addition, many businesses have also begun developing a social media strategy.

Social media users total millions throughout the world, and people are more connected to these accounts than ever before with the rise of smartphones and mobile devices. A company that also has social media accounts on sites like Twitter or Facebook, will likely have a greater chance of attracting users. In fact, of the 88% of users that researched products online in 2012, about half of them followed up on social media before making a purchase.

A Facebook page allows a user to get quick facts about a company’s products or services, and gives them insight into how many people \”like\” the page. If the user decides to \”like\” the page, this action will show up on their friends’ homepage, which might prompt other users to visit the page as well. A user can also suggest the page to friends, increasing a an account’s exposure. Similarly, the number of followers a company has on Twitter can positively impact traffic to its website and give users a chance to communicate with others about their impression of the site.

When developing a social media strategy, the importance of blogging cannot be overlooked. Companies that blog have 424% more indexed pages than ones that do not, and these websites also attract 55% more traffic. After creating high quality content for the blog, promoting posts on social media is one of the best ways to get consumers to visit a website. Re-posting portions of the content on Twitter, Facebook, LinkedIn, and other social media outlets urges users to finish reading the post and explore a company’s site.

While social media is not the only way to appeal to consumers, it is becoming one of the fastest ways to do so. Some users are connected to their social media accounts 24 hours a day, and constantly check their phones for updates.
